What kind of career is modeling?

At present, the modeling industry is divided into two modes, the first is the traditional mode, and the second is the network mode. Details are as follows:

Traditional mode

The birth of a model as a professional model is always inseparable from fashion, but in everyone's eyes, it is a short-lived "youth meal". Especially with the rapid development of modeling industry and the increase of employees, the peak period of modeling has been shortened, and even at the age of 23 or 4, it has reached the edge of "retirement".

There are more and more models now, and the market for models is becoming wider and wider.

According to the psychological investigation and analysis of models, the psychological pressure of models in their peak period mainly comes from the competition of peers and the trend of re-development. Another survey shows that less than 1% of models in China can switch to the film and television industry every year. About 30% of models over the age of 25 become agents, and a few well-known models start their own businesses, while most older models will leave the industry after "retirement".

Online model

A new mode-Madou, a new online Madou, also known as online mode, online shop mode and online Madou, is mainly a display carrier for e-commerce network operators to promote products. This noun is also a special title for online merchants! Among them, universality, sensuality and click-through rate are the conditions for the sustainable development of a network model. High income and fashionable clothes attracted many girls to join. After the attention of "Madou", they will continue to gather popularity. It should be said that among these online models, it is very likely that there will be online stars who become famous overnight, or online celebrities with high network popularity.

Online models are mostly part-time students, and their requirements for figure are lower than those of traditional models. The main requirements are as follows: height 160- 170cm, strong sense of lens/expression, well-proportioned figure, good image and temperament, sweet face, ability to make up, weight about 45kg, fair skin, hard work. Some people call online modeling a new industry. Some fashionistas call them "the most common idols".

With the rapid development of online shopping mode, the competition among online stores is becoming more and more fierce. In order to improve their competitiveness, many large online stores have invited "network models" to help out. Network modeling has developed rapidly.
